ResourceARNNotValidException#
- class CloudTrail.Client.exceptions.ResourceARNNotValidException#
This exception is thrown when the provided resource does not exist, or the ARN format of the resource is not valid. The following is the valid format for a resource ARN:
arn:aws:cloudtrail:us-east-2:123456789012:channel/MyChannel
.Example
try: ... except client.exceptions.ResourceARNNotValidException as e: print(e.response)
